Leroy and New Chicago are places in Indiana.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
New Chicago has the higher population (2,348 vs 278 in Leroy).
Population, income & housing
| Leroy | New Chicago |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 278 | 2,348 |
| Median age | 50.2 yrs | 30.4 yrs |
| Median household income | — | $54,700 |
| Median home value | — | $118,900 |
| Median gross rent | — | $1,090 |
| Housing units | 147 | 980 |
| Homeownership rate | 24.5% | 68.2%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 0.0% | 17.0% |
| Unemployment rate | 0.0% | 7.9% |
